Over 1,000 Children Remain In Mandatory Evacuation Zone Of Donetsk Region


(MENAFN- UkrinForm) Head of the Children's Service of the Donetsk Regional Military Administration, Yuliia Ryzhakova, reported this during an online briefing, an Ukrinform correspondent reports.

“In four settlements across three territorial communities where mandatory evacuation of children is enforced - together with parents, guardians, or other legal representatives - 1,163 children remain, which represents 904 families,” Ryzhakova said.

She added that the largest number of children still reside in Druzhkivka town territorial community - 1,155 children from 900 families.

According to Ryzhakova, 186 children from 144 families were forcibly evacuated from the region over the past week, most of them from Druzhkivka community - 171 children from 132 families.

As reported, the mandatory evacuation of children and their families from Donetsk region began on April 7, 2023.
